Abstract
Previous studies have demonstrated that bamboo exhibits distinct mechanical properties under tensile and compressive loading, characterized by differing moduli of elasticity. This asymmetry implies that the neutral axis of a bamboo cross-section under bending should not lie at mid-height. However, experimental validation of the neutral axis position remains limited. This study aims to comprehensively investigate the bending behavior of Wulung bamboo by considering the tensile and compressive elastic moduli parallel to the grain. Tensile, compressive, and flexural tests were performed according to ISO 22157:2019. The results revealed that the average tensile modulus of elasticity was 15,789 MPa for internodes and 13,716 MPa for nodes, while the average compressive modulus of elasticity was 21,270 MPa and 15,264 MPa, respectively. The neutral axis was consistently located below the geometric center of the cross-section, ranging from approximately �0.03D to �0.09D, where D is the average outer diameter of the bamboo culm. A modification factor for the tensile and compressive elasticity moduli was introduced to achieve internal force equilibrium in flexural analysis. A finite element analysis is recommended to further simulate the interaction between the position of the neutral axis, the modified tensile and compressive elastic moduli parallel to the grain, and the overall flexural behavior of the bamboo. ISO 22156:2021 remains applicable at the design stage, provided material behavior remains within the linear-elastic domain. However, a more detailed analysis of the stress-strain distribution along the fiber direction would help support and refine the structural design process. © 2025 The Korean Society of Wood Science & Technology.
